Course Content

• Introduction to IIoT Platforms and Smart Parking Systems
• Sensor Technologies for Smart Parking: Ultrasonic, Magnetic, and Vision-Based Systems
• Data Acquisition and Communication Protocols in IIoT for Smart Parking: MQTT, CoAP, and REST APIs
• Cloud Platforms and Data Analytics for Smart Parking: AWS IoT, Azure IoT, Google Cloud IoT
• Smart Parking System Design and Architecture
• Cybersecurity in Smart Parking IIoT Systems
• Implementing and Deploying IIoT-based Smart Parking Solutions
• Case Studies and Best Practices in Smart Parking
• Advanced Data Analytics and Predictive Modeling for Smart Parking Optimization
